About Mining Law in Dasmarinas, Philippines

Mining Law in Dasmarinas, Philippines refers to the set of legal rules and regulations governing the exploration, extraction, and management of mineral resources within the area. Mining activities are regulated to ensure the responsible use of mineral resources, protection of the environment, respect for indigenous communities, and compliance with national and local requirements. While Dasmarinas is largely urban and residential, some areas may still be subject to mining-related concerns, such as quarrying, sand and gravel extractions, or environmental impacts of nearby mining operations. Understanding the relevant legal framework is essential for anyone intending to explore or engage in mining activities within the locality.

Local Laws Overview

In the Philippines, mining activities are primarily governed by the Republic Act No. 7942 or the Philippine Mining Act of 1995, along with its implementing rules and regulations. However, local government units (LGUs) such as Dasmarinas have significant power to regulate and control mining and quarrying operations within their jurisdictions. This is enshrined in Republic Act No. 7160, known as the Local Government Code of 1991, which grants LGUs authority to issue permits for small-scale mining and quarrying, particularly for sand, gravel, and other loose materials.

The City of Dasmarinas may impose its own additional ordinances regarding environmental protection, zoning, and land use. These local ordinances must be observed alongside national laws. Moreover, the Environmental Compliance Certificate (ECC) from the Department of Environment and Natural Resources (DENR) is often required to demonstrate that potential mining operations will not cause undue harm to the environment.

Permit applicants and existing operators should be familiar with these national and local requirements, including the application process, reporting obligations, and environmental safeguards expected by the Dasmarinas city government.

Frequently Asked Questions

What is considered "mining" under Philippine law?

Mining generally refers to the exploration, extraction, and processing of minerals such as gold, copper, nickel, sand, gravel, and other materials from the earth. This includes both large-scale and small-scale operations.

Do I need a permit to engage in mining or quarrying in Dasmarinas?

Yes, you must secure the proper permit from the Dasmarinas City Government, as well as approvals from the DENR and possibly other agencies, depending on the type and scope of your operation.

Who regulates mining activities in Dasmarinas?

Mining is regulated at both the national and local levels. The DENR and its Mines and Geosciences Bureau (MGB) oversee national compliance, while the Dasmarinas city government manages permits and local ordinances.

Are there areas in Dasmarinas where mining is prohibited?

Yes, local zoning ordinances and national protected area laws may designate specific lands where mining or quarrying is prohibited, such as residential zones, schools, and environmentally sensitive areas.

What are the penalties for illegal mining or quarrying in Dasmarinas?

Penalties may include fines, imprisonment, confiscation of equipment, and revocation of permits. The severity of penalties depends on the nature of the violation and the laws breached.

How can affected communities or landowners seek compensation for mining-related damages?

Affected individuals may file complaints with the DENR, the local government, or pursue claims in court with the assistance of a lawyer specializing in mining law.

What environmental requirements must be met for mining operations?

Mining operators typically need to secure an Environmental Compliance Certificate (ECC) and conduct Environmental Impact Assessments (EIA) to ensure measures are in place to prevent or mitigate environmental harm.

Are small-scale mining activities also regulated?

Yes, small-scale mining and quarrying are subject to regulation and permit requirements, often managed directly by the local government under the guidance of the Philippine Mining Act.

Can indigenous peoples prevent mining on their ancestral lands?

Yes, the Indigenous Peoples' Rights Act (IPRA) protects ancestral domains, and any mining activities on such lands require Free and Prior Informed Consent (FPIC) from the indigenous communities.

What documents are needed to apply for a mining or quarrying permit in Dasmarinas?

Requirements typically include a completed application form, proof of ownership or authority over the land, Environmental Compliance Certificate, project proposal, and other supporting documents as specified by the city or DENR.
